Protection and traction: safety across variable urban surfaces

The city is a collage of textures — granite curbs, wet subway platforms, icy sidewalks, and uneven cobblestones. For urban explorers, the single most important value of better sneakers is reliable protection and traction. Look for soles with a compound designed for wet grip and abrasion resistance; Vibram-style rubber or rubber blends with a deep tread pattern reduce slips on wet or salted pavement. A reinforced toe box and a protective rand help prevent scuffs and extend life when you encounter construction sites or gravel underfoot.

  • Water resistance: A DWR-treated knit or a leather upper with sealed seams keeps slush and light rain out while allowing breathability.
  • Midsole stability: EVA with a supportive shank prevents foot fatigue on long urban walks.
  • Salt and grit resistance: Look for soles specified as salt-resistant to avoid premature breakdown in winter months.

Comfort and ergonomics for extended walking days

Urban exploration means distance: commuting across town, walking between meetings, or following a museum route. Premium sneakers prioritise ergonomic design — anatomically shaped footbeds, sufficient toe-box volume, and heel counters that stabilise without rubbing. Features to prioritise include removable orthotic-friendly insoles, dual-density midsoles for impact absorption, and engineered knit or full-grain leather uppers that mould to your foot over time rather than forcing it into a rigid shape.

Concrete insight: an average city professional covers 6–10 kilometres on a busy day. A sneaker with a well-cushioned midsole reduces peak impact forces by up to 20%, which lowers fatigue and the risk of joint discomfort. Choose a slightly roomier toe box for walking comfort and a firmer heel for stability when navigating curbs or escalators. Durability and cost-per-wear: the financial case for premium sneakers

Investing in quality sneakers is an exercise in cost-per-wear. A premium pair built from resilient materials and finished with repairable soles can last several seasons, while fast-fashion alternatives often degrade after a few months. Use this simple calculation to compare:

Item Price (CAD) Estimated wears / year Years usable Cost-per-wear
Premium urban sneaker $320 200 3 $0.53
Fast-fashion sneaker $75 100 0.75 $1.00

Concrete takeaway: even at a higher initial outlay, premium footwear often costs half as much per wear as disposable options because of longer usable life and the potential for resoling. Design and versatility: dressing for work and leisure

Urban explorers require footwear that transitions between contexts: a morning commute, a client lunch, an evening at a gallery. Better sneakers combine a considered silhouette with premium materials — full-grain leather, hand-finished details, and a refined sole profile — so they read as intentional rather than athletic. Neutral palettes (midnight, cognac, slate) and subtle stitching keep sneakers compatible with tailored trousers, chinos and smart denim.

  • Business casual compatibility: Leather or polished-coated knit uppers provide a tailored look appropriate for offices.
  • Travel-friendly features: Quick-dry linings and slip-on lacing systems reduce friction and speed security checks.
  • Styling note: A clean, unbranded toe and low-profile sole pair best with tailored outerwear.

Care and maintenance for Canadian seasons

Year-round longevity depends on seasonal care. Urban explorers face freeze-thaw cycles, road salt and summer humidity. A simple maintenance routine preserves materials and appearance:

  • Brush off grit after each wear and wipe away salt immediately with a damp cloth.
  • Apply a leather conditioner or synthetic-safe protector before winter; reapply every 6–8 weeks if you wear the pair often.
  • Rotate pairs — giving shoes 24–48 hours between wears allows moisture to evaporate and midsole materials to recover.

FAQ — Urban explorer sneakers

Q: What makes a sneaker suitable for winter in Canada?
A: Winter-ready sneakers combine water-resistant uppers, insulating liners, and a sole compound rated for low-temperature grip. Sealed seams and a higher sidewall help keep slush out. Look for salt-resistant soles to prevent fast deterioration.

Q: Can leather sneakers be practical for heavy city use?
A: Yes. Full-grain leather offers durability and polish. When treated for water resistance and maintained regularly, leather sneakers can be both practical and elegant for urban exploration.

Q: How often should I resole premium sneakers?
A: Frequency depends on wear, but a rule of thumb is to inspect every 12–18 months for thinning. Resoling at 50–60% wear restores performance and is more sustainable than replacement.
